November 18, 2020 The Commissioner for Emergency, Domenico Arcuri, sent

the anti-Covid vaccine plan to the

presidents of the regions and to the ministers of health and regional affairs 

for information.



The plan speaks of

3.4 million doses of Pfizer anti-covid vaccine

that will be administered

to the first 1.7 million Italians at the end of January.



The plan envisages that the hospitals chosen for the administration of the doses "must be able to vaccinate at least

2,000 people (or more people but with multiples of 1,000) in 15 days"

.

The structures must also have freezers inside them, with specific characteristics that allow

temperatures up to -75 degrees,

and its volume of available space. 

Furthermore, the



conservation characteristics of

the vaccine "provide that it can be kept for 15 days from delivery in the supplier's storage bags and for six months, if cold rooms are available at a temperature of -75 0 c ± 15 0 c".

The delivery characteristics of this first vaccine "require, to ensure its integrity, that it is exclusively delivered by the supplier directly to each point of administration (in special storage bags containing, at most, 5 boxes of 975 doses each)". 



"It seems a priority to safeguard those places that during the pandemic represented the main channel of contagion and spread of the virus, such as, for example

, hospitals and residential facilities for the elderly.

To this end, it could be envisaged in this first phase to administer the vaccine directly in hospitals and, through mobile units, in residential facilities for the elderly ". 



"For the other incoming vaccines, intended for all other categories of citizens, different methods of administration will be provided, in line with the ordinary vaccination management through a large-scale campaign" thanks

"to drive-throughs

, starting from people with a high level of frailty ", reads the plan for anti-covid vaccines.   



In the document sent to the governors on the vaccine plan, the emergency commissioner asked the regions to send,

by November 23

, the table with the number and name of hospitals and RSA.

And for each hospital the number of health and non-health personnel.
